Offset Printing for High-Volume, Consistent Quality
Offset printing remains the preferred choice for large-scale print jobs that demand uniformity and superior color fidelity. This technique involves transferring ink from a metal plate onto a rubber blanket before printing onto paper, ensuring crisp details and consistent color throughout lengthy runs. It is often utilized for corporate branding materials, catalogs, and high-volume brochures where maintaining quality across thousands of copies is essential.

Ensuring Proper File Preparation for Optimal Printing Results
To achieve high-quality outputs from your document printing services, meticulous preparation of your digital files is essential. Proper file preparation minimizes reprints, reduces delays, and ensures the final product aligns with your expectations.
- Preferred File Formats: PDF files remain the industry standard for print projects due to their ability to preserve layout, fonts, and images consistently. Additionally, high-resolution TIFF and JPEG formats are suitable for image-heavy documents, but it is crucial that these images are at least 300 dpi to prevent pixelation.
- Resolution and Image Quality: Ensuring images and graphics are at a suitable resolution is vital. Low-resolution images can appear blurry or pixelated once printed, undermining the professional appearance of your documents. Always verify that images are created at 300 dpi or higher for sharp, clear visuals.
- Color Settings and Profiling: Files should be prepared using the CMYK color mode rather than RGB. CMYK accurately represents the inks used in printing, leading to color consistency between digital proofing and the final print. Incorporate color profiles such as ISO-coated V2 to match standard printing conditions.
- Bleed and Margin Considerations: For documents with images or designs extending to the edges, include a bleed area of at least 0.125 inches. This prevents unwanted white borders after trimming. Maintain safe margins within the document layout to avoid cropping essential text or graphics.
- Submission Methods: Most professional printers accept files via secure online portals, email, or cloud storage. Ensure that files are compressed correctly to reduce upload times while maintaining quality. Confirm submission deadlines and specify any special instructions regarding finishing options or binding preferences.

Cost factors and pricing structures
Understanding the pricing framework for document printing helps in budgeting and evaluating different service providers. Cost factors typically include:
- Print Volume: Larger quantities often benefit from economies of scale, reducing the per-unit cost.
- Material Choices: Higher-quality paper, specialty finishes, or custom sizes influence pricing.
- Color vs. Black and White: Color printing generally costs more due to the use of multiple inks and advanced color management.
- Finishing and Bindery: Additional processes like lamination, folding, or binding add to the overall expense.
- Delivery and Turnaround: Express services or complex logistics can increase costs but offer quicker results.

File preparation and submission tips
Ensuring that digital files are correctly prepared enhances print quality and minimizes errors. Best practices include:
- Use High-Resolution Files: Files should be minimum 300 dpi for clear, sharp images and text.
- Optimize Color Settings: Convert colors to CMYK for accurate color reproduction in print.
- Embed Fonts and Graphics: To prevent font substitutions or layout issues, embed all fonts and linked images within the file.
- Check Bleeds and Margins: Incorporate standard bleed areas (usually 3mm) and safe margins to prevent unwanted cropping.
- File Formats: PDF is universally preferred, ensuring compatibility and preserving design integrity.
Submitting files through designated channels, such as secure online uploads or physical media, ensures smooth processing. Confirm file specifications with the printing provider beforehand to avoid delays or compromises in output quality.
Environmental considerations and sustainable printing
As organizations and individuals become increasingly aware of their environmental impact, the adoption of eco-friendly printing practices has gained prominence in the realm of document printing services. Utilizing recycled paper reduces the demand for virgin pulp, helping to conserve natural resources and decrease deforestation. Recycled paper often goes through a process that minimizes chemical usage, contributing to better air and water quality during production.
Beyond paper sourcing, the selection of sustainable inks plays a crucial role. Soy-based or vegetable-based inks tend to produce fewer volatile organic compounds (VOCs) compared to traditional petroleum-based inks. These inks are not only more environmentally friendly but also offer vibrant colors and sharp print quality.
Many printing providers incorporate energy-efficient machinery and adopt environmentally conscious workflow practices, such as reducing waste and recycling paper scraps. Some also participate in certification programs that recognize their commitment to sustainability, which can help clients align their printing needs with their corporate social responsibility goals.

Additional Considerations for Secure Document Printing
When selecting a document printing service, ensuring the security and confidentiality of sensitive information is essential. Reputable providers implement various measures to protect your data throughout the printing process, which is particularly important for legal, financial, or personal documents. These measures include secure file transfer protocols, encrypted storage, and restricted access to printing facilities.
Many providers also adopt on-demand printing models that minimize document storage time, reducing exposure to data breaches. Additionally, physical security protocols such as monitored printing areas, secure disposal of waste paper containing sensitive information, and staff background checks contribute to maintaining confidentiality.
For organizations with strict compliance requirements, it is advisable to work with printing services that offer recording and audit trails of printing activities. This transparency ensures accountability and enables tracking of who printed what, when, and where. Such practices are vital for legal compliance and maintaining trust with clients and stakeholders.
Enhancing Efficiency Through Automated Printing Systems
Automated printing solutions are transforming how businesses handle large-volume documents, offering increased efficiency and consistency. These systems can integrate with enterprise software and document management platforms, enabling seamless workflow automation. Features such as job scheduling, batch processing, and automatic reprinting reduce manual intervention and minimize errors.
Implementing secure print release stations is another advancement that combines efficiency with security. Users release print jobs only after verifying their identity, which helps prevent unauthorized access and ensure that sensitive materials are not left unattended in output trays.
